/*!**************************************************************************************************************************************************************************!*\
  !*** css ./node_modules/css-loader/dist/cjs.js!./node_modules/postcss-loader/dist/cjs.js!./node_modules/sass-loader/dist/cjs.js!./css/navigation/nav-mobile-button.scss ***!
  \**************************************************************************************************************************************************************************/
.gin-secondary-toolbar {
  display: none;
}

.gin-secondary-toolbar {
  display: none;
}

html.lenis, html.lenis body {
  height: auto;
}

.lenis.lenis-smooth {
  scroll-behavior: auto !important;
}

.lenis.lenis-smooth [data-lenis-prevent] {
  overscroll-behavior: contain;
}

.lenis.lenis-stopped {
  overflow: hidden;
}

.lenis.lenis-smooth iframe {
  pointer-events: none;
}

.actions__item {
  height: 50px;
  list-style: none;
  overflow: hidden;
  width: 50px;
}
.actions__item > * {
  height: 100%;
  width: 100%;
}
.actions__item--menu-toggle {
  background: var(--rood);
  display: grid;
  padding: 0.65rem;
  place-items: center;
}

.menu-toggle {
  background: transparent;
  border: 0;
  border-radius: 0;
  cursor: pointer;
  display: grid;
  height: 18px;
  padding: 0;
  place-items: center;
  position: relative;
}
.menu-toggle__title {
  background-color: var(--white);
  display: block;
  height: 2px;
  text-indent: -200vw;
  transition: background-color 200ms ease-in-out 200ms;
  width: 100%;
}
.menu-toggle__title::before, .menu-toggle__title::after {
  background-color: var(--white);
  content: "";
  height: 2px;
  left: 0;
  position: absolute;
  transform-box: fill-box;
  transform-origin: center center;
  transition: transform 300ms ease-in-out, top 300ms ease-in-out 200ms, bottom 300ms ease-in-out 200ms;
  width: 100%;
}
.menu-toggle__title::before {
  top: 0;
}
.menu-toggle__title::after {
  bottom: 0;
}
.menu-open .menu-toggle__title {
  background-color: transparent;
  transition: background-color 200ms ease-in-out;
}
.menu-open .menu-toggle__title::before, .menu-open .menu-toggle__title::after {
  transition: transform 300ms ease-in-out 200ms, top 300ms ease-in-out, bottom 300ms ease-in-out;
}
.menu-open .menu-toggle__title::before {
  top: calc(50% - 1px);
  transform: rotate(45deg);
}
.menu-open .menu-toggle__title::after {
  bottom: calc(50% - 1px);
  transform: rotate(-45deg);
}

/*# sourceMappingURL=nav-mobile-button.min.css.map*/